1. What is the HVAC Cost Formula?

The residential HVAC replacement cost formula provides a quick estimate for budgeting purposes. It calculates cost based on home square footage at a standard rate of $6.50 per square foot.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Is this estimate accurate for all homes?
A: This is a base estimate. Actual costs may vary based on system type, local labor rates, and home specifics.

Q2: What factors can increase the cost?
A: Ductwork modifications, high-efficiency systems, smart thermostats, or complex installations can increase costs.

Q3: Does this include both heating and cooling?
A: Yes, this estimate covers complete HVAC system replacement including both heating and cooling components.

Q4: How often should HVAC systems be replaced?
A: Typically every 10-15 years, depending on maintenance and system quality.

Q5: Should I get multiple quotes?
A: Yes, always get 3-5 professional quotes for accurate pricing in your area.
